The Hyperflite K-10 Competition Standard Dog Disc 6-Pack is a professional-grade flying disc designed for canine competitions and recreational play. Featuring patented grip surfaces and X-Flash Anti-Glare technology, these 8.75-inch plastic discs offer ultra-long flights and secure handling in all weather conditions. Lightweight and buoyant, they float on water, making them ideal for versatile outdoor fun. Border Collie recommended from long time user
I just ordered my 4th set of these and thought I would contribute a review. I've been really happy with this product. I have a border collie we play catch with these 2x per day 365 days with few exceptions. I live in Nebraska, so my discs bake in the sun part of the year and freeze in the snow part of the year. The discs I use daily are left in the elements and I make zero effort to care for them. I get at least 1 year of life out of them, but in time the sun will fade the color out of the yellow and orange discs, while the black and white discs pretty much hold the original color. Eventually the material becomes brittle and cracks from the element exposure and that is when I retire them. Given my lack of care, I have been pleased with the longevity. The weight of the discs provides a good balance of long flight and float. Your dog has to be trained to know this is a catch and retrieve toy and not a chew toy, so for a puppy or untrained dog you are going to sacrifice a disc or 2 during your training process. The edges sometimes get marked up a bit after a year or more of catches, but it has been rare that my dogs have ended up with any bleeding of the gums. Seems like most of the edge marking occurs when the discs are older and harder. They have a bit more flex when new. I am not quite sure when I bought my first set but could be 8-9 years ago. Since I found these, I have used nothing else.

Not best for strong mouthed dogs but they do float well
I have a shepherd mix that's strong mouthed. The Hyperflite Frisbee line of products is a good one- I generally buy the "JawZ" model but bought the "Competition" this time because they float. They do float well but unfortunately my dog and her hard bite are going through them pretty quickly just in the course of throw and retrieve. So like most things in life there is a trade off, they float well, are easy on your dogs teeth but the material won't hold up to a hard mouthy dog. There is no perfect frisbee, in my experience-

Quality Frisbees
These frisbee are quality frisbees. They are a great size and weight. They are just as pictured, in terms of the colors I received. The only thing to be aware of is the fact that these are not puncture or chew proof. I have some hyperflite discs that are puncture proof and chew proof and are great. However, upon receiving the box I left the room for a bit and found that my golden retriever helped herself to one and had already had bits of it chewed up. If you use them as you should then they are great. **** Update - 12/08/11 Rather than purchase the bulk set I would look for a chew proof frisbree. These dent up with very little effort from my very petite, timid, and extremely gentle female golden retriever. I seriously don't make that up about my dog...she is a scaredy cat and is extremely gentle. She loves to play fetch, but even just retrieving the discs have put so many marks and dents and cut the plastic that the discs don't fly well at all anymore. A while ago I had a hyperflite chew proof disc that was awesome. Now if I could find where I put it!
